comment:126 in reply to: ↑ 125 Changed 6 years ago by
Replying to zimmerma:
about the issue from comment 121 (GOT not supported on Windows), I can't help on that. Please can someone provide a patch?
Note that the assembly line from 121 gives issues on OS X not Windows:
call abort@plt
The problematic line on Windows from #21223 is the previous one which uses:
$_GLOBAL_OFFSET_TABLE
The workaround I suggested is to use --disable-assert
as both these lines are surrounded by a (m4
-equivalent) of #ifdef HAVE_ASSERT
.
A proper fix would be to:
- find equivalent assembly on OS X and Windows to keep asserts support,
- or always disable this code path on OS X and Windows.
comment:127 Changed 6 years ago by
This comes from: https://gforge.inria.fr/scm/viewvc.php/ecm/trunk/x86_64/mulredc1.asm?r1=1460&r2=1526 and yes it is not portable!
In fact this only appeared here because in configure.ac (https://gforge.inria.fr/scm/viewvc.php/ecm/trunk/configure.ac?view=markup#l51):
dnl Assertions are enabled by default for beta/rc releases.

Francois, I guess you are compiling GMP-ECM with MPIR, not with GMP. Since there is currently no public FFT interface for GMP, and the internal functions differ between GMP and MPIR, I decided to only support the GMP side. Thus unless someone volunteers to maintain GMP-ECM up to date with changes in MPIR (apparently fft_adjust_limbs now disappeared), MPIR will not be supported any more.
Paul

- Status changed from needs_work to needs_review
comment:157 Changed 5 years ago by
Thanks I was working on this but it will be faster to just review this patch.
comment:158 Changed 5 years ago by
- Reviewers set to Jean-Pierre Flori
- Status changed from needs_review to positive_review
- Work issues Fix doctests and pexpect interface to ecm deleted
comment:159 Changed 5 years ago by
- Status changed from positive_review to needs_work
Testsuite fails:
[ecm-7.0.4.p0] ********** Factor found in step 2: 4190453151940208656715582382315221647 [ecm-7.0.4.p0] Found prime factor of 37 digits: 4190453151940208656715582382315221647 [ecm-7.0.4.p0] Prime cofactor 543423179434447039008165356160798838947285203071935410761431031147 has 66 digits [ecm-7.0.4.p0] GMP-ECM 7.0.4 [configured with MPIR 2.7.2, --enable-asm-redc] [P+1] [ecm-7.0.4.p0] Save file test.pp1.save already exists, will not overwrite [ecm-7.0.4.p0] ############### ERROR ############### [ecm-7.0.4.p0] Expected return code 0 but got 1 [ecm-7.0.4.p0] Makefile:2521: recipe for target 'longcheck' failed [ecm-7.0.4.p0] make[3]: *** [longcheck] Error 1 [ecm-7.0.4.p0] PASS: test.pm1 [ecm-7.0.4.p0] PASS: test.pp1 [ecm-7.0.4.p0] PASS: test.ecm [ecm-7.0.4.p0] ============================================================================ [ecm-7.0.4.p0] Testsuite summary for ecm 7.0.4 [ecm-7.0.4.p0] ============================================================================ [ecm-7.0.4.p0] # TOTAL: 3 [ecm-7.0.4.p0] # PASS: 3 [ecm-7.0.4.p0] # SKIP: 0 [ecm-7.0.4.p0] # XFAIL: 0 [ecm-7.0.4.p0] # FAIL: 0 [ecm-7.0.4.p0] # XPASS: 0 [ecm-7.0.4.p0] # ERROR: 0 [ecm-7.0.4.p0] ============================================================================ [ecm-7.0.4.p0] make[6]: Leaving directory '/mnt/disk/home/buildslave-sage/slave/sage_git/build/local/var/tmp/sage/build/ecm-7.0.4.p0/src' [ecm-7.0.4.p0] make[5]: Leaving directory '/mnt/disk/home/buildslave-sage/slave/sage_git/build/local/var/tmp/sage/build/ecm-7.0.4.p0/src' [ecm-7.0.4.p0] make[4]: Leaving directory '/mnt/disk/home/buildslave-sage/slave/sage_git/build/local/var/tmp/sage/build/ecm-7.0.4.p0/src' [ecm-7.0.4.p0] make[3]: Leaving directory '/mnt/disk/home/buildslave-sage/slave/sage_git/build/local/var/tmp/sage/build/ecm-7.0.4.p0/src' [ecm-7.0.4.p0] Error: GMP-ECM's test suite failed.
comment:160 Changed 5 years ago by
Looks like a race condition in the test suite.
comment:161 Changed 5 years ago by
Yes, from Makefile.am
longcheck: ecm$(EXEEXT) $(srcdir)/test.pp1 "$(VALGRIND) ./ecm$(EXEEXT)" $(srcdir)/test.pp1 "$(VALGRIND) ./ecm$(EXEEXT) -no-ntt" $(srcdir)/test.pp1 "$(VALGRIND) ./ecm$(EXEEXT) -modmuln" $(srcdir)/test.pp1 "$(VALGRIND) ./ecm$(EXEEXT) -redc" $(srcdir)/test.pp1 "$(VALGRIND) ./ecm$(EXEEXT) -mpzmod" $(srcdir)/test.pm1 "$(VALGRIND) ./ecm$(EXEEXT)" $(srcdir)/test.pm1 "$(VALGRIND) ./ecm$(EXEEXT) -no-ntt" $(srcdir)/test.pm1 "$(VALGRIND) ./ecm$(EXEEXT) -modmuln" $(srcdir)/test.pm1 "$(VALGRIND) ./ecm$(EXEEXT) -redc" $(srcdir)/test.pm1 "$(VALGRIND) ./ecm$(EXEEXT) -mpzmod" $(srcdir)/test.ecm "$(VALGRIND) ./ecm$(EXEEXT)" $(srcdir)/test.ecm "$(VALGRIND) ./ecm$(EXEEXT) -no-ntt" $(srcdir)/test.ecm "$(VALGRIND) ./ecm$(EXEEXT) -modmuln" $(srcdir)/test.ecm "$(VALGRIND) ./ecm$(EXEEXT) -redc" $(srcdir)/test.ecm "$(VALGRIND) ./ecm$(EXEEXT) -mpzmod" $(srcdir)/test.ecm "$(VALGRIND) ./ecm$(EXEEXT) -treefile tree" $(srcdir)/testlong.pp1 "$(VALGRIND) ./ecm$(EXEEXT)" $(srcdir)/testlong.pm1 "$(VALGRIND) ./ecm$(EXEEXT)" $(srcdir)/testlong.ecm "$(VALGRIND) ./ecm$(EXEEXT)"
and on both bots the test are probably with -j8
. Each instance of test.pp1
can write test.pp1.save
. There could be similar problem with other tests. The only solution, I think, is to run the longcheck serially.
